Age Demand For Pup Daycare
A pup daycare is the most effective method to mingle your canine and give them with much-needed mental and physical excitement. It is best to do so before they start teenage years, when they will be a lot more prone to stress and anxiety and aggressiveness.
Pups can be enrolled in canine day care as very early as 12 weeks after obtaining their core vaccinations. This enables them to start organized socializing and build confidence in a new atmosphere.

Besides being a superb source of mental stimulation, young puppy childcare aids pups develop social skills and proper play rules. It likewise protects against boredom and damaging habits such as chewing shoes or digging openings. Day care can likewise aid pups prone to separation anxiety. The daily routine of play, napping, and feeding supplies uniformity that aids pups really feel safe and secure.
Preferably, puppies should start going to canine day care between 12 and 16 weeks old. This is the age when they have received their preliminary round of vaccinations and are mature enough to interact with other dogs in a safe environment.
Nonetheless, it is important to remember that every pup is various and some might require even more time before they adjust to day care. A good rule of thumb is to start with a few check outs a week and raise the frequency progressively. Over-tired young puppies are extra susceptible to illnesses and actions problems. So, it is necessary to ensure that your pup gets lots of rest after each day care session.
Pups ought to be immunized
If you have a puppy, it is very important that they are up-to-date on all their inoculations. This will certainly help them communicate securely with other canines and individuals. A veterinarian can figure out the best injection timetable for puppies. Inoculations are generally given in 2 to four-week periods until your young puppy is 16 weeks old. Along with an extensive test, your puppy will get numerous injections.
Core young puppy shots/vaccinations consist of DAPPv, which protects against canine distemper, adenovirus (hepatitis), parvovirus, and parainfluenza; and the rabies vaccine, which prevents the potentially fatal rabies virus. The rabies injection is lawfully called for in many states. In addition, non-core puppy injections can include the lyme illness vaccination, leptospirosis vaccination, and Bordetella, which protects against kennel cough. The last is suggested for pups and pet dogs that see dog parks, groomers, travel, or be boarded. It is also useful to go to a veterinary-approved pup socializing course during this moment. This will permit your young puppy to have fun with other immunized pet dogs and humans in regulated environments.
Pups ought to be mingled
Puppy childcare offers a structured environment for your pet dog to shed power and socialize. It additionally provides puppies the boarding for dogs near me opportunity to learn exactly how to interact safely with individuals and other dogs, which is essential for their growth. Young puppy daycare can additionally aid with basic training, such as potty training and chain walking.
Throughout pup socializing courses, your puppy will be revealed to various other pups of different breeds, ages, and dimensions as well as individuals and kids. They will certainly be allowed to communicate with them quickly yet not for prolonged amount of times. Puppy classes may also subject your pup to new things, such as skateboards, wheelchairs, shopping carts, bikes, and cages; and sounds like hoover, music, and sounds from the kitchen area or veterinary workplaces.
However, it is necessary to keep in mind that puppies are not suggested to come across so many individuals and places at once. This can be overwhelming and create them to establish fearful responses as adults.
Young puppies should be well-adjusted
Pups who aren't mingled are at a better danger of creating behavioral troubles such as hostility, too much chewing, or splitting up stress and anxiety. An excellent daycare needs to be a safe and organized environment where the pup's caregiver can maintain a close eye on his behavior. They must additionally provide constant walks and play sessions to aid him burn off excess power.
A reliable pet dog daycare will certainly have team with training in animal actions and emergency care, such as mouth-to-mouth resuscitation. They should likewise have smaller sized playgroups to prevent over-stimulation and make sure the safety of each young puppy. They need to also have a stringent inoculation policy to avoid the spread of conditions.
Young puppies are most responsive to brand-new experiences during the important socialization window, which lasts from 3 to 14 weeks old. It's important to subject pups to people and other pet dogs throughout this time, however just in controlled atmospheres like a monitored pup class or home events with immunized pets.
